WebPackets and Encapsulation UNIX can support a variety of physical networks, including Ethernet, FDDI, token ring, ATM (Asynchronous Transfer Mode), wireless, and serial-line-based systems. Hardware is managed within the link layer of the TCP/IP architecture, and higher-level protocols do not know or care about the specific hardware being used. In order for the [RFC4340] encapsulation to pass through Network ... how to sand semi gloss paintWebIPv6 Datagram Encapsulation and Formatting Delivery of data over IPv6 internetworks is accomplished by encapsulating higher-layer data into IPv6 datagrams. These serve the same general purpose for IPv6 as IPv4 datagrams do in the older version of the protocol. However, they have been redesigned as part of the overall changes represented by IPv6. northern trust private banking perks
